Transaction 706fae5e3454ce3c0229880c92e7a47443678194fa2c52502e29d04df7b7e084

2 Input
1 Outputs
  • 706fae5e3454ce3c0229880c92e7a47443678194fa2c52502e29d04df7b7e084:0
  • value  686857
    address  3A2aUrmX8qSq7d1fNcAM6rG1VHy1qYXkcQ